19 DUI Arrests in Operation Turkey Chase

Initiative designed to deter underage drinking on Black Wednesday

Officials in Montgomery County arrested 19 people for driving under the influence on Black Wednesday -- the night before Thanksgiving.

Law enforcement officials said the drivers were arrested Wednesday evening during their Operation Turkey Chase. Officials stopped vehicles at two different checkpoints -- Wisconsin Avenue at Jones Bridge Road and Old Georgetown Road at Battery Lane -- to look for drunken drivers.

Officers also issued 138 traffic citations during the pre-Thanksgiving traffic stops.

Black Wednesday is known as one of the busiest nights of the year for underage drinking. The Turkey Chase initiative was designed to deter underage drinking.
